Kingship (Al-Mulk)
In the name of Allah, the Merciful, the Compassionate
۞ Blessed be He in whose Hand is the Kingdom, He is powerful over all things, 1 Who hath created life and death that He may try you which of you is best in conduct; and He is the Mighty, the Forgiving, 2 who created the seven heavens, one above the other. You cannot see any inconsistency in the creation of the Merciful. Return your gaze, do you see any crack! 3 Then return your gaze once more and yet again, your gaze comes back to you dazzled, and tired. 4 And indeed We have adorned the nearest heaven with lamps, and We have made such lamps (as) missiles to drive away the Shayatin (devils), and have prepared for them the torment of the blazing Fire. 5 And for those who disbelieve in their Lord will be the torment of Hell; and a hapless destination! 6 When they are thrown into it, they hear from it a [dreadful] inhaling while it boils up. 7 Well-nigh it bursteth with rage. So oft as a company is cast thereinto, the keepers thereof will ask them: came there not unto you a warner? 8 They say, 'Yes indeed, a warner came to us; but we cried lies, saying, "God has not sent down anything; you are only in great error. 9 They will say, "If we had only listened or understood, we should not now be among the inmates of Hell," 10 So will they confess their guilt. Deprived (of all joys) will be the inmates of Hell. 11 As for those who fear their Lord in the unseen will have forgiveness and a rich reward. 12 And conceal your speech or publicize it; indeed, He is Knowing of that within the breasts. 13 Would He not know, He Who has created, when He is All-Subtle, All-Aware? 14
